Files<br />
The source codes will be downloaded into the gforge repository under the<br />
[amigo] / ius/user_interface / gesture_service / 3D_gesture_service:<br />
The folder 3DGesture<strong>Service</strong> includes .NET based clientserver program.<br />
The folder RecogniserInstaller includes installer software for the recogniser.<br />
The folder TrainerInstaller includes installer software for the trainer.<br />
